Description

Molybdate CAS NO 14259-85-9 refers to a class of inorganic salts containing the molybdate anion (MoO₄²⁻), a crucial source of molybdenum. This versatile compound is essential as a corrosion inhibitor, catalyst precursor, and a vital micronutrient in agricultural applications. It is a key raw material for industries including water treatment, metal finishing, chemical manufacturing, and fertilizer production, where consistent quality and reliable supply are paramount.

Application

  • Corrosion Inhibition: A primary component in closed-loop cooling water systems and industrial water treatment formulations to protect ferrous and non-ferrous metals from pitting and corrosion.
  • Catalyst Manufacturing: Serves as a critical precursor in the production of hydrodesulfurization (HDS) and oxidation catalysts used in petroleum refining and chemical synthesis.
  • Agriculture & Fertilizers: Used as a source of molybdenum, an essential micronutrient for leguminous crops (e.g., soybeans, peas) to facilitate nitrogen fixation.
  • Pigments & Ceramics: Employed in the manufacture of corrosion-resistant pigments (e.g., zinc molybdate) and to enhance the properties of ceramic glazes and colors.
  • Metal Finishing & Plating: Acts as a chemical brightener and corrosion-resistant additive in electroplating baths and surface treatment processes.
  • Laboratory & Analytical Reagent: Utilized in analytical chemistry for phosphate determination and as a standard in various spectrophotometric methods.
